<blockquote data-quote="NSMaple1" data-source="post: 4683673" data-attributes="member: 113429"><p>A proper secondary burn unit can get more heat out of the same amount of wood than a non-secondary burn unit. It burns & gets heat out of what would otherwise go up the chimney as smoke or stick to it in the form of creosote. More efficient. Been there, done that, seen it with my own eyes. So put me in the 'believe-in-magic' corner too, I guess.</p></blockquote><p></p>
